DS avoids … hunslet st mary\\u0027s primary school leeds網頁Is a shunt the same as a stent? A stent is slightly different from a shunt. A shunt is a tube that connects two previously unconnected parts of the body to allow fluid to flow between them. Stents and shunts can be made of similar materials but perform two different tasks.
